Understanding ADHD in Adults
ADHD is defined by signs such as in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. In adults, symptoms can include:
Difficulty focusing or following through on jobsDisorganization and lapse of memoryImpulsivity in decision-makingConcerns with time managementUneasyness and difficulty unwinding
It's important to acknowledge that everybody may experience some of these signs occasionally; ADHD is detected based upon the persistent and destructive effect of these symptoms on daily functioning.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: What if I didn't have ADHD signs as a kid? Can How Do I Get A ADHD Diagnosis still be detected as an adult?

A: Yes, it is possible to be identified with ADHD as an adult even if symptoms weren't recognized or identified in childhood. Numerous grownups may have developed coping systems or might not have actually displayed overt signs during their younger years.

Q: What types of professionals can identify ADHD?

A: Professionals who can diagnose ADHD include psychologists, psychiatrists, neurologists, and some certified scientific social workers. It's crucial to choose somebody with experience in adult ADHD.

Q: Will I be evaluated?

A: The diagnosis of ADHD Diagnosis UK Adult does not generally include "testing" in the way one might believe (e.g., blood tests). Rather, it is based on interviews, questionnaires, and a review of your history and symptoms.

Q: Can I get a diagnosis online?

A: There are online evaluation tools that can supply preliminary insights, but a formal diagnosis ought to be made in-person by a qualified professional. Online platforms might provide telehealth visits for evaluations.

Q: What are the treatment alternatives if I'm detected with ADHD?

A: Treatment alternatives for adult ADHD vary and can consist of medication (such as stimulants or non-stimulants), psychotherapy (such as cognitive behavioral therapy), training, and lifestyle changes like organizational abilities training.
